    Sammanfattning : Complement activation occurs during inflammatory joint diseases such as rheumatoid arthritis (RA) and is thought to contribute to the chronic inflammation observed within the joints. Previous studies have shown that certain cartilage components of the small leucine-rich repeat protein (SLRP)-family regulate complement activity, thereby possibly contributing to disease progression.     Sammanfattning : Dendritic cells are key players during HIV pathogenesis, and shape both the immediate immune response at the site of infection as well as directing the adaptive immune response against the virus. HIV has developed a plethora of immune evasion mechanisms that hijack dendritic cell functions, suppressing their ability to mount an accurate immune response and exploiting them for efficient viral transfer to target T cells.
